Road cycling routes around Bavilliers offer diverse landscapes within the Bourgogne-Franche-Comté region of France. The area features accessible cycling routes, including sections of the EuroVelo 6, known for its gentle gradients. For more challenging rides, the proximity to the Parc Naturel Régional des Ballons des Vosges provides significant elevation changes and hilly terrain. The region also includes scenic canal paths along the Canal du Rhône au Rhin and routes through forests and past lakes like Étang des Forges and Lac…

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of terrain and elevation can I expect when road cycling around Bavilliers?

The Bavilliers region offers a diverse range of terrain. You'll find accessible routes with gentle gradients, particularly along sections of the EuroVelo 6 and the Canal du Rhône au Rhin. For more challenging rides, the proximity to the Parc Naturel Régional des Ballons des Vosges provides significant elevation changes and hilly terrain, including historic passes like the Ballon d'Alsace and climbs like La Planche des Belles Filles.

Are there challenging road cycling routes in Bavilliers for experienced riders?

Yes, experienced riders will find challenging routes, especially those heading towards the Vosges mountains. For example, the Sewen Lake – Col du Ballon d'Alsace loop from Belfort is a difficult 103.2 km route with over 1300 meters of elevation gain, leading through mountainous terrain towards the historic Ballon d'Alsace.

Are there easy or family-friendly road cycling routes in Bavilliers?

Absolutely. The region features many easy routes suitable for a more relaxed pace or family outings. The Canal du Rhône au Rhin offers flatter, more leisurely cycling opportunities along its towpaths. An example of an easy route is the Memorial to the fallen 🕊️ – Allenjoie lock intersection loop from Belfort, a 42.1 km path that takes about 1 hour 41 minutes to complete.

What natural features or scenic viewpoints can I see while cycling around Bavilliers?

Road cycling routes around Bavilliers often pass through picturesque landscapes. You can enjoy views of verdant forests, tranquil lakes such as Étang des Forges and Lac du Malsaucy, and scenic canal paths along the Canal du Rhône au Rhin. Routes like the View of Belfort loop from Belfort offer specific scenic viewpoints of the city and surrounding area.

Are there any historical sites or attractions accessible by bike near Bavilliers?

Yes, the region blends natural beauty with historical landmarks. Cyclists can easily integrate visits to nearby attractions such as the imposing Citadel of Belfort and the iconic Lion of Bartholdi. Other historical sites include Fort Senarmont and Fort de Vézelois, offering cultural points of interest alongside your ride.
